Job summary

Salmon Group is seeking an Investigation Officer to support fraud prevention and case management across the organization. You will handle end-to-end investigations, analyze digital and operational evidence, and collaborate with internal teams to mitigate risks and support legal actions when needed.

This role requires a criminology background, 3+ years in investigations in finance or security, and proficiency with Microsoft Office.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in criminology or related four-year program.
  • Experience in investigation within financing, banking, or security is preferred.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, PowerPoint).
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

Responsibilities

  • Manages cases received through Shared Mailbox and Hotline.
  • Conduct Initial Investigation of cases triggered or received from other departments.
  • Ensure data collection for End to End investigation.
  • Provide technical support to investigation, litigation, and forensic analysts to collect, preserve, process, analyze and interpret digital evidence.
  • Investigate assigned cases at various risk levels.
  • Implement fraud prevention and investigation programs, policies, systems, documentation, and investigation plans.
  • Conduct covert and overt investigation.
  • Conduct surveillance and counter-surveillance.
  • Represent Company in the prosecution and litigation of cases as required.
  • Coordinate with other Internal Departments for Risk Mitigation Strategy.
  • Manage Business Intelligence (Mystery Shopping).
